New molecular-imaging network launched to benefit cancer, dementia imaging and new radiopharmaceuticals - National Imaging Facility

Summary by National Imaging Facility
A new national-scale molecular-imaging network that aims to improve cancer imaging, dementia diagnosis and treatment, and new radiopharmaceuticals was launched today at the annual meeting for Australian and New Zealand Society of Nuclear Medicine.
